Turner Construction, the Lead Building Contractor of the Martin Luther King, Jr. National Memorial, Celebrates Industry Pioneers at Dedication
WASHINGTON, Oct. 12,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- As the lead contractor for the MTTG Joint Venture team responsible for designing and building the Martin Luther King Jr. National Memorial, Turner Construction Company (TCC) continues to commemorate this historic project by celebrating living pioneers in the architecture, engineering and construction industries. TCC specifically recognizes its Sr. Vice President of Community Affairs Mr. Hilton O. Smith, as a Lifetime Pioneer.

MTTG Joint Venture (comprised of McKissack & McKissack, Turner Construction Company, Tompkins Builders and Gilford) was selected as the architect and builder for the Martin Luther King Jr. National Memorial on the National Mall which will be officially dedicated by President Barack Obama on Sunday, October 16, 2011.
"Our collective strength, experience and track record, as the premier builder in the nation, helped convince the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. Memorial Foundation Board of Directors that Turner should be the contractor of choice," says Smith commenting on how Turner Construction was selected as the lead contractor. "Our experience building projects on the mall weighed heavily in our favor."
Throughout his illustrious career Mr. Smith has spearheaded the corporate efforts to award over $19 billion in contract awards to minority and woman owned businesses. "Certainly, our history of supporting and working with minority and women-owned business enterprises was a major factor," continues Smith. "Overall, we are blessed to have had the opportunity to construct the renowned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. Memorial."
Mr. Smith has been invited by the Martin Luther King Jr. Foundation as a VIP to be seated in the forecourt to witness the ceremony.
